"Extreme Makeover Home Edition 1/22"
Did anyone see tonight's show about the Hebert family? It was in Sandpoint, Idaho, which is a hop, skip and a jump from Spokane, where I live. They built the house in November. Our local ABC affiliate did a "behind the scenes" special right before the show aired. Pretty interesting to get more of what goes on to make the show. They had to build a road up to the property in order to get everything to the house site. And I guess the contractors had to talk the producers into still doing the house, basically because of accesibility issues. Anyway, it was a great show. I did not get the opportunity to go to the site, but it's neat to have it happen nearby.
